Copa America: Your Pocket Guide to Teams, Schedule and Watching Live

The Copa America is South America’s oldest international football tournament and one of the most exciting events on the football calendar. It brings national teams from across the continent together for intense matches, sudden moments of brilliance, and rivalries that run deep. Whether you follow Argentina, Brazil, Uruguay or underdog stories, the tournament serves drama and big moments.

Here you will find simple, useful info on how the tournament works, who to watch, key dates, and ways to stream or catch highlights. I’ll focus on practical tips so you can follow matches without fuss.

How the tournament works

Copa America usually has a group stage followed by knockout rounds. Teams are split into groups and play round robin matches. The top teams then move on to quarterfinals, semifinals and the final. Tiebreakers are goal difference, goals scored and head to head results. Extra time and penalties decide knockout matches when needed.

Squad rules and substitutions can change by edition, so check the official tournament site for the latest. Coaches often use group games to test tactics and then tighten their lineups for the knockout phase.

Who to watch and simple tips

Big names often shine, but keep an eye on emerging talents from smaller nations. Watch the midfield creators and attacking fullbacks; South American teams love quick transitions and technical play. Set pieces also swing games, so teams with good dead ball takers matter more than you might expect.

If you want quick updates, follow official team accounts and tournament social pages. For live stats, use apps that show lineups, shots, expected goals and substitutions. They make it easy to follow if you can’t watch every minute.

If you bet or make predictions, check recent form, travel schedules and injury lists. International tournaments can be unpredictable, and fatigue plays a role when teams travel long distances between games.

For families watching with kids, pick matches with strong storylines or rivalry to keep interest high. Kickoff times vary, so plan snacks, short breaks and half time activities to avoid missing key moments.

Want instant highlights? Official channels usually post clips within minutes of key events. Short highlight reels focused on goals and saves are the fastest way to catch up after work or school.

The Copa America is full of passion, skill and surprise results. With a few simple tools—an official schedule, a stats app, and smart alerts—you can follow every match and enjoy the drama without stress.

Quick checklist before match day: confirm kickoff times in your local time zone, set two alerts (kickoff and half time), download a reliable stats app, bookmark the official Copa America page for team news, and pick a streaming option before the match to avoid last minute fees or geoblocking. If you care about commentary language, test audio ahead of time. Share the match link with friends to create a watching group and make the game more fun. Enjoy every second live.
